The other side is blank. ## The correct imprint is likely GG 225 (They G's kind of look like 6's). This pill contains 25mgs of Promethazine, the active ingredient in Phenergan. It is commonly used to help treat or prevent nausea and vomiting. (NDC 0781-1830) Inactive Ingredients: - Lactose Monohydrate - Cellulose, Microcrystalline - Magnesium Stearate Common side effects can include: drowsiness, dizziness, dry mouth and constipation. Ref: DailyMed ## Thank you ## Is this pill a narcotic? ## No, Promethazine is not a narcotic.

it is a round yellow pill with the numbers 44 225 on it ## The round yellow pill imprinted with "44 255" is identified as Aspirin (81 mg) enteric coated. Aspirin is often used as an analgesic to relieve minor aches and pains, as an antipyretic to reduce fever, and as an anti-inflammatory medication. V white round ## The pill in description with a "V"-like logo on one side and "225 356" on the other is rumored to be a product of BF Ascher by the brand name "Mobigesic". Active Ingredients: Magnesium Salicylate (325 mg) Phenyltoloxamine Citrate (30 mg) Imprint: Ascher logo 225/356 Pill Appearance: White; Round Tablet Indications: Mobigesic is a muscle relaxant used for treating muscle spasms, pain & discomfort. Availability: Prescription Needed Inactive Ingredients: -Magnesium Stearate -Microcrystalline Cellulose -Povidone -Silicon Dioxide I hope this helps!
